Related Product Features:
Features a robust spiral steel armor for superior protection against rodent bites, crushing, and tensile stress.
Equipped with a ceramic ferrule for stable data exchange and high plug resistance, supporting over 1000 plugging cycles.
Available in various connector models including SC, FC, LC, and ST to suit different interface requirements.
Constructed with LSZH (Low Smoke Zero Halogen) sheathing for high-temperature resistance and environmental safety.
Offers low insertion loss (≤ 0.35dB) and high return loss (UPC ≥ 50dB, APC ≥ 60dB) for rapid, reliable data transmission.
Supports customizable lengths, diameters, and fiber types including G652D, G657A1, and multimode options.
Designed with a small bending radius (15x cable diameter) and high flexibility for easy installation in tight spaces.
Undergoes rigorous testing to ensure tensile strength exceeds 70N and performance across a wide temperature range (-25°C to +70°C).
FAQs:
What are the main protective features of this armored fiber optic patch cable?
The cable is protected by a spiral steel armor, metal woven mesh, and aramid layers, making it highly resistant to rodent bites, crushing, and tensile forces, while the LSZH sheath provides flame retardancy and environmental safety.
Can the cable length and connector types be customized?
Yes, the product length is fully customizable, and it is available with various connector models including SC, FC, LC, and ST, with ferrule end face options of UPC or APC to meet specific project requirements.
What is the operating temperature range and insertion loss for this patch cable?
The cable operates effectively in temperatures from -25°C to +70°C and features a low insertion loss of ≤ 0.35dB, ensuring efficient and stable data transmission across its working wavelengths.
How durable is the connector in terms of plugging and unplugging?
The connector, built with a ceramic ferrule, is designed to withstand over 1000 plugging and unplugging cycles while maintaining stable performance and low interchangeability loss (≤ 0.2dB).
